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

We send a trained technician to ass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. This helps us develop a comprehensive plan to restore your restaurant to its original condition. Our team uses advanced equipment, like th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den moisture and ensure a thorough inspection.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using industrial-grade pumps and vacuum systems, our technicians ext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the area.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e environment for your customers and employees.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team uses advanced cleaning solutions and equipment to sanitize and clean the affected area. This step is essential in removing b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ants that can pose health risks.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our technicians will begin the restoration and reconstruction process. This may include repairing or replacing damaged drywall, flooring, and other structural elements.

Warning Signs You Need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age issues early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age. Here are some warning signs that show you need restaurant water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Foul od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your restaurant,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ice water stains or leaks on your ceiling, walls, or floors,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Mold Growth or Black Spots

Mold growth or black spots can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ice mold growth or black spots in your restaurant,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Discoloration or Warping of Walls or Ceiling

Discoloration or warping of wal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age. If you notice discoloration or warping of your walls or ceiling,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Visible Leaks Under Sinks or Appliances

Visible leaks under sinks or appliances can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ice leaks under sinks or appliances,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ost in Haymarket, VA

The cost of restaurant water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Haymarket, VA. These estimates are not guarantees, and actual costs may vary.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The type of cleaning agents and equipment need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the type of materials needed
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 The complexity of the job and the type of equipment needed
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 The type and duration of equipment rental needed
